At Ray Summit 2025, Josh Karpel from Workday shares how the company rebuilt its ML model-serving architecture using Ray Serve—enabling massive scale, high availability, and dramatic cost reductions for Workday’s customers.
He begins by outlining the core challenge Workday faced in early 2023: serving dedicated ML models for every tenant across every environment had become increasingly expensive and difficult to scale. The solution was a ground-up redesign built on Ray Serve, which now powers tens of thousands of models across more than a dozen environments. With Ray Serve’s built-in autoscaling and efficient request routing, Workday achieved 50× cost savings while maintaining low latency and strong reliability.
Josh then covers the less conventional aspects of Workday’s system—unique usage patterns that pushed Ray Serve far beyond its original design. Early deployments ran into scalability ceilings with just a few dozen applications, but thanks to Ray’s open-source nature, Workday contributed a series of critical improvements that now allow Ray Serve to support thousands of applications per cluster.
In this talk, Josh dives deep into how Workday uses Ray Serve for large-scale model serving, the architectural challenges encountered while scaling, and the contributions made back to the Ray community to overcome them.
